Carbon Encapsulated Metal Nano-materials Synthesis and Application
-
摘要: 本文主要介绍了目前碳包覆纳米金属材料的主要合成途径及其形成机理,主要合成途径有:电弧放电法、化学气相沉积法、高温热解法、低温热解法、聚能法、爆炸法、机械球磨法等。根据合成工艺,总结阐述了碳包金属材料在电磁性存储、微电子技术、生物医学、催化材料、光电辐射技术等不同领域的应用。Abstract: Synthesis technology and formation mechanism of carbon encapsulated metal nanometerials,such as arc discharge,chemical vapor deposition,pyrolysis,low temperature pyrogenation,cumulative method,detonation method and mechanical milling is described.Application of the carbon encopsulated metal nanometerials in the fields of electromagnetic storage,micro-electronics technology,biological medicine,catalytic materials and optical radiation is introduced.
